John Barr created this bead head emerger fly after a frustrating day on Nelson's Spring Creeks. That night in his room, the Barr Emerger was born and with it one of the most productive emerger patterns on the market. This bead head fly is often used as the bottom fly on his famous Hopper, Copper, Dropper three fly rig. In blue wing olive. Sizes: 18, 20, 22.
